Compare all specifications:
1975 Aston Martin Lagonda | 1984 Honda Civic | |
Make | Aston Martin | Honda |
Model | Lagonda | Civic |
Year Released | 1975 | 1984 |
Body Type | Sedan | Hatchback |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 5338 cc | 1488 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 0 HP | 101 HP |
Drive Type | Rear | Front |
Transmission Type | Automatic |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 3 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 2200 kg | 855 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4930 mm | 3810 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1840 mm | 1640 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1360 mm | 1350 mm |
